Latest Patents

Sinden's latest patents focus on the use of aldehyde donors for stabilizing peroxides. His first patent describes a method of stabilizing hydrogen peroxide in an aqueous solution, which includes a peroxide such as hydrogen peroxide itself. The invention presents a process for adding an aldehyde donor, such as methylolhydantoin, to this solution. It has been discovered that these aldehyde donors significantly reduce the decomposition of hydrogen peroxide by catalase and other peroxide-decomposing enzymes, particularly in recycled paper. This method allows for a more efficient bleaching process, requiring less hydrogen peroxide to achieve desired results. More importantly, the aldehyde donors are safe to handle and cost-effective.

Additionally, another embodiment of Sinden's invention involves a method for bleaching recycled papers in a circulating water slurry. This method also incorporates the use of hydrogen peroxide and an aldehyde donor to enhance the bleaching effect. Furthermore, Sinden's work includes a technique for inhibiting catalase and other peroxide-decomposing enzymes in an aqueous solution, demonstrating the versatility and practicality of his inventions.
